CHAPTER 4: The Arrival
When they finally reached Hogsmeade Station, Draco looked everywhere for Piper. Rachel had left him. Rubeus Hagrid, the Hogwarts gamekeeper, called her to come with him so she could get sorted before the beginning of the year feast started. He walked around for a couple more minutes; he couldn't find Crabbe and Goyle anywhere either so he just found a carriage to ride in to Hogwarts. The carriage was full of second year girls. Some of them screamed when it started to move.
After a good fifteen minutes of girls' giggling, staring, screaming, pointing and whispering, they had finally arrived. The horseless carriages each stopped to let everyone out. Draco got out, finally found Crabbe and Goyle; they were in the carriage behind the one he was sitting in. They all went up to the castle, and into the Great Hall where they sat down at the Slytherin table with the rest of the fifth years.
When everyone had came in, the double doors to the hall opened and Professor McGonagall led the scared little first years to the front of the Great Hall. Draco remembered four years ago when he was standing up there, dreading to be sorted into anything less than Slytherin. Professor McGonagall pulled up a three-legged stool and held up the Sorting Hat.
"Welcome back to Hogwarts everyone. Now, when I call your name, you will come forth, I shall place the Sorting Hat on your head and you will be sorted into your houses." said Professor McGonagall.
"Ankara, John!"
A pale little boy with red hair walked up to the stool, sat down in it, and a couple of seconds later, the sorting hat had shouted, "RAVENCLAW!" The Ravenclaw table exploded with applause.
"Bellevue, Sheryl!"
"HUFFLEPUFF!"
"Bunts, Ashley!"
"SLYTHERIN!"
Ashley Bunts was a stout girl. She went and sat down to a couple of third year girls. When they finished sorting, there were two Ravenclaws, seven Gryffindors, six Hufflepuffs and three Slytherins.
Professor Dumbledore, the headmaster, stood up and waited until the noise from the crowd had died down.
"Now. This is a new year and I know all of you are excited." he paused and looked at the lot of them.
"There will be a number of occasions happening this year. First, I would like to announce that Quidditch will be in its normal season, the new captains had been picked. The captain for Gryffindor is none other than Harry Potter!" there was loud cheering at the Gryffindor table for Harry. Dumbledore waited for the noise to die down patiently.
"The new captain for Slytherin is Draco Malfoy!" The Slytherin table erupted with even louder cheering for Draco. He was so happy. Now he'll show that Potter what Quidditch is all about. Dumbledore continued.
"Sadly, we don't have Cedric Diggory with us anymore, due to the events of last year. So the position for Seeker for Hufflepuff will be filled. Auditions are going to be held at noon on the thirteenth of September. Quidditch will start a little later than usual this year, so I suggest you all to keep your eyes open for fliers hanging on the walls.
"Second, I would like to say that there will be a Yule Ball happening on the twenty fifth of December, which, of coarse is Christmas. The rules apply are the same. Anyone who wishes to go has to be in the fourth year and above. Which means that if you are in the years four, five, six and seven, you have the permission to invite a students below your year, so they have the opportunity to enjoy the ball as much as you do.
"Thirdly, I would like to say that there are five new students in two of the upper grades. Their names are Piper Haliwell, fifth year Slytherin, Rachel Malfoy, sixth year Slytherin, Aislinn Njass, fifth year Slytherin, Prudence Masengrea, fifth year Gryffindor and Peeper PouPea, fifth year Gyffindor. I trust you will all make them feel at home. That is all. Let the feast begin!"
As soon as he had said that, the plates in front of them all filled with different kinds of delicious food. The house ghosts all swooped in the Great Hall. The Bloody Baron, who was the Slytherin house ghost and covered with silver blood stains, swooped on top of the table and waved his sword, laughing.
"Look, it's the Bloody Baron!" some first years laughed, pointing.
When the feast ended, Draco, Crabbe and Goyle all went down to the dungeons to the Slytherin common room.
* * *
The next day, Draco felt extremely tired. He couldn't get to sleep last night, so he stayed up until three in the morning. His alarm clock rang at six o'clock. He got dressed in his uniform, and headed down to the Great Hall for breakfast.
Professor Snape, the head of Slytherin house, gave everyone in his house a piece of parchment, which had their schedules on it. Draco tried to find Rachel, but soon remembered that she was still in the common room with the rest of the new girls. Draco's schedule had three classes with the Gryffindors:
8:00-9:00 Care of Magical Creatures (Slytherin with Gryffindor)
9:10-10:40 Herbology (Slytherin with Hufflepuff)
10:50-11:50 Transfiguration (Slytherin with Gryffindor)
LUNCH
1:10-2:10 Divination (Slytherin with Hufflepuff)
2:20-3:20 Arithmancy (Slytherin with Ravenclaw)
BREAK
Double Potions (Slytherin with Gryffindor)
4:40-5:40 1st Hour
BREAK
6:00-7:00 2nd Hour
DINNER
Some of the Slytherin fifth years groaned when they read what they had. Draco did too.
When he finished his breakfast, he got up and went outside to Care of Magical Creatures. It was extremely cold out; the sky looked like it was about to rain. Draco shivered; it was too early for them to be outside.
"Ah, there yeh are, Malfoy." Hagrid called to him. "Yeh're la'. Now pick a cage and stan' next to yer partner. She's over there." He pointed to a girl who looked very similar to Piper, except she didn't have freckles. Her hair was hanging in strands in front of her face. Piper was partnered off with Harry Potter.
Draco walked over to his partner; she was already standing next to a very large cage, which was covered up with a towel.
"What are we supposed to be doing this time?" he asked Hagrid.
"Yeh'll find out. Now wait until I call yer name and see if yeh're all here. Then take off the towels and yeh'll see what you will be takin' care of fer the year." He paused to see the look on the students' faces. "What do you mean? 'See what you will be taking care of'?" said Draco.
"Well, it's exactly what it sounds like. In these cages under the towels here, there are different kinds of birds. Each of yeh will be takin' care of the species yeh get. Each day, yeh will have homework to research what each of these creatures eat and how they live. Today, after I give the word, yeh will uncover the creature yeh will have to take care of fer the rest of the semester.
"Now. Today's home and class work will be fer yeh all ter write notes on yer creature. Yeh will discuss with yer partner what name yer creature will have and how yeh will take care of it." said Hagrid. He wrote something on the piece of parchment he was holding and then looked up at all of them.
"When I'm finished talkin', lift the cover and come here ter get the paper that includes what species yer creature is and what the best ways ter take care of it are. All right. Go ahead now." Hagrid finished and there was a hustle to uncover the cages and controversy over who would get the paper from Hagrid.
Draco uncovered the cage and inside was a large beautifully coloured bird. The body was ebony and it's eyes were scarlet.
The girl he was supposed to working with had gone to get the paper Hagrid was handing out. When she had come back she was clutching in her shivering hands.
"Wow." she muttered, staring at the bird.
"Yeah, I know. .What's your name?" said Draco.
"Aislinn Njass." she said.
"Oh, I'm Draco Malfoy." he said.
"Hi." said Aislinn.
"Hi. What type of bird is it?" said Draco.
"Oh, um.it's a Red Eyed Phoenix." said Aislinn. She looked back up at him. "It says here that it likes to eat nuts, Cornish Pixies and it hunts mongoose."
"Harsh, I thought Phoenix were supposed to be nice to other animals?" said Draco, standing up and facing Aislinn.
"So did I." said Aislinn, looking at the bird.
Towards the end of the class, Hagrid told them that their homework assignment was to write a couple facts on their bird and the name they had chosen for it. Aislinn had suggested Delfin to be its name, so Draco agreed, since he didn't really care what the bird's name was, as long as it had one.
The rest of his classes were about as boring as Care of Magical Creatures was. But when they were all over, Draco went back to the common room.
Draco said the password, "Priori Incatatem," and the door invisible door slid open to reveal a quite large lair.
Draco entered and when he did, he saw Piper sitting on the black leather couch in the room.
"Hi. Where'd to go, on the Hogwarts Express?" said Draco.
She looked up from the thing she was working and shrugged.
"Look, I know you went somewhere, so where'd you go?" he said as he walked over to where she was sitting.
She shrugged again, but this time gave a sly smile. Draco sat down on the couch across from her.
"Do you and Rachel have some kind of rival going on?" he asked her.
"Maybe." Said Piper.
"Yea, that's what she said. How come you transferred from Durmstrang? I hear it's a great school." said Draco.
"That, is something that you have to figure out on your own." said Piper. She got up, swooped up her books and parchment and walked off up to the girls' dormitories.
"Why won't any one answer my questions?" muttered Draco to himself.
